General Comments

EVERYTHING about Star Wars: Republic Commando is lame and mediocre. It's hardly anything of what it claims. It's so kiddie-arcade; it would make even Jar-Jar and Barney nauseated.

Graphics are circa 1997, and the enemies are dumber than asteroids. Your team-mates love to wait until you're ready to shoot, then stand right in front of you. Gameplay and level design just doesn't get any more boring or linear than this. Everything around you is brightly lit and flashing - telling you exactly where to go and exactly what to do. And if somehow you're still uncertain, there's this tiny, high-pitched kids voice always telling you, along with your teammates in-between the bad jokes. Speaking of jokes, that is exactly what this game is.

If you want a good First-Person Star Wars Shooter, get ANY of the Jedi Knight Series games, even back to the first one.
